.icone-emoji{line-height:40px;margin:10px}.emoji-picker{background:#fff;position:absolute;bottom:6.3rem;left:3.5%;max-width:93%;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.emoji-picker .emoji-header{display:-webkit-box;display:-ms-flexbox;display:flex;padding:5px;-webkit-box-shadow:0 5px 9px 0 rgba(0,0,0,.15);box-shadow:0 5px 9px 0 rgba(0,0,0,.15)}.emoji-picker .emoji-header .emoji-close{margin-left:auto}.emoji-picker .emoji-content{margin-top:10px;overflow-y:auto;height:230px}.emoji-picker span{cursor:pointer;font-size:25px;padding:1px}.typer-preview{-webkit-box-sizing:border-box;box-sizing:border-box;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;bottom:0;height:4.9rem;width:100%;position:relative;margin:auto;background-color:hsla(0,0%,84.3%,.8)}.typer-preview input[type=text]{left:2vw;padding:2%;width:80%;background-color:transparent;border:none;outline:none;font-size:1.25rem}.typer-button-preview{margin-right:2%!important}.imagem-preview{max-width:55%;height:auto}@media(max-width:550px){.imagem-preview{max-width:calc(80vw - 5rem)}}.imagem-giphy{max-width:calc(7vw + 3rem)}.gif-picker{background:#fff;position:absolute;bottom:6.3rem;left:3.5%;width:93%;max-width:93%;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}@media(max-width:550px){.gif-picker{bottom:1.3rem}}.gif-picker .emoji-header{display:-webkit-box;display:-ms-flexbox;display:flex;padding:5px;-webkit-box-shadow:0 5px 9px 0 rgba(0,0,0,.15);box-shadow:0 5px 9px 0 rgba(0,0,0,.15)}.gif-picker .gif-header .gif-close{margin-left:auto}.gif-picker .gif-content{margin-top:10px;overflow-y:auto;height:500px}.gif-picker span{cursor:pointer;font-size:25px;padding:1px}.image-card{display:inline-block;margin:5px;cursor:pointer;height:10vh;-webkit-box-shadow:#000 0 0 1px;box-shadow:0 0 1px #000}.results-box{margin-top:10px;overflow-y:auto;height:210px}.first-search{margin:50px auto 0 auto;width:80%;max-width:500px;display:block}.no-results{text-align:center;margin-top:20px}.chat-component{background-color:hsla(0,0%,84.3%,.8)!important}@media(max-width:550px){.chat-component{height:50px}}.avatar-custom{width:60px;height:60px;min-height:60px}@media(max-width:550px){.avatar-custom{width:12px!important;height:8px;min-height:8px;min-width:35px!important}}.avatar-img{width:48px;height:48px}@media(max-width:550px){.avatar-img{width:28px;height:28px}}.v-slide-group{display:-webkit-box;display:-ms-flexbox;display:flex}.v-slide-group:not(.v-slide-group--has-affixes)>.v-slide-group__next,.v-slide-group:not(.v-slide-group--has-affixes)>.v-slide-group__prev{display:none}.v-slide-group.v-item-group>.v-slide-group__next,.v-slide-group.v-item-group>.v-slide-group__prev{cursor:pointer}.v-slide-item{display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;-webkit-box-flex:0;-ms-flex:0 1 auto;flex:0 1 auto}.v-slide-group__next,.v-slide-group__prev{-webkit-box-align:center;-ms-flex-align:center;align-items:center;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-flex:0;-ms-flex:0 1 52px;flex:0 1 52px;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;min-width:52px}.v-slide-group__content{-ms-flex:1 0 auto;flex:1 0 auto;position:relative;-webkit-transition:.3s cubic-bezier(.25,.8,.5,1);transition:.3s cubic-bezier(.25,.8,.5,1);white-space:nowrap}.v-slide-group__content,.v-slide-group__wrapper{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-flex:1}.v-slide-group__wrapper{contain:content;-ms-flex:1 1 auto;flex:1 1 auto;overflow:hidden;-ms-touch-action:none;touch-action:none}.v-slide-group__next--disabled,.v-slide-group__prev--disabled{pointer-events:none}.card-date{text-transform:uppercase}.card-date,.card-date-started{border-radius:10px;max-width:150px;text-align:center;margin:10px auto;font-size:14px;padding:4px;color:#000;background:#b0bec5;display:block;overflow-wrap:break-word;position:relative;white-space:normal;-webkit-box-shadow:0 1px 3px 0 rgba(0,0,0,.2),0 1px 1px 0 rgba(0,0,0,.14),0 2px 1px -1px rgba(0,0,0,.12);box-shadow:0 1px 3px 0 rgba(0,0,0,.2),0 1px 1px 0 rgba(0,0,0,.14),0 2px 1px -1px rgba(0,0,0,.12)}.text-bold{font-weight:700}.text-italic{font-style:italic}.text-strike{text-decoration:line-through}.text-underline{text-decoration:underline}.text-inline-code{display:inline-block;color:var(--chat-markdown-color);margin:2px 0;padding:2px 3px}.text-inline-code,.text-multiline-code{font-size:12px;background:var(--chat-markdown-bg);border:1px solid var(--chat-markdown-border);border-radius:3px}.text-multiline-code{display:block;color:var(--chat-markdown-color-multi);margin:4px 0;padding:7px}#cabecalho{min-height:40%}.text-timestamp{font-size:10px;padding-left:5px;color:#000;text-align:right;padding-top:9px}.girar{position:relative}.girar *{line-height:0;-webkit-box-sizing:border-box;box-sizing:border-box}.girar:before{height:20%;min-width:5px;background:#000;opacity:.1;bottom:0;border-radius:50%;-webkit-animation:quadrado-shadow .5s linear infinite;animation:quadrado-shadow .5s linear infinite}.girar:after,.girar:before{content:"";width:100%;position:absolute;left:0}.girar:after{height:100%;background:#cabba0;-webkit-animation:quadrado-animate .5s linear infinite;animation:quadrado-animate .5s linear infinite;bottom:40%;border-radius:3px}@-webkit-keyframes quadrado-animate{17%{border-bottom-right-radius:3px}25%{-webkit-transform:translateY(20%) rotate(22.5deg);transform:translateY(20%) rotate(22.5deg)}50%{-webkit-transform:translateY(40%) scaleY(.9) rotate(45deg);transform:translateY(40%) scaleY(.9) rotate(45deg);border-bottom-right-radius:50%}75%{-webkit-transform:translateY(20%) rotate(67.5deg);transform:translateY(20%) rotate(67.5deg)}to{-webkit-transform:translateY(0) rotate(90deg);transform:translateY(0) rotate(90deg)}}@keyframes quadrado-animate{17%{border-bottom-right-radius:3px}25%{-webkit-transform:translateY(20%) rotate(22.5deg);transform:translateY(20%) rotate(22.5deg)}50%{-webkit-transform:translateY(40%) scaleY(.9) rotate(45deg);transform:translateY(40%) scaleY(.9) rotate(45deg);border-bottom-right-radius:50%}75%{-webkit-transform:translateY(20%) rotate(67.5deg);transform:translateY(20%) rotate(67.5deg)}to{-webkit-transform:translateY(0) rotate(90deg);transform:translateY(0) rotate(90deg)}}.text-deleted{font-style:italic}.icon-deleted{height:14px;width:14px;vertical-align:middle;margin:-3px 1px 0 0;fill:var(--chat-room-color-message)}.text-ellipsis{width:100%;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.img-gif{max-height:30vh}.message-image{position:relative;background-repeat:no-repeat!important;border-radius:4px;-webkit-transition:filter .4s linear;transition:filter .4s linear}.image-loading{-webkit-filter:blur(3px);filter:blur(3px)}.icon-scroll{position:absolute;bottom:28%;right:50%;padding:8px;background:#fff;border-radius:50%;-webkit-filter:opacity(80%);-moz-filter:opacity(80%);-o-filter:opacity(80%);-ms-filter:opacity(80%);filter:opacity(80%);-webkit-box-shadow:0 1px 1px -1px rgba(0,0,0,.2),0 1px 1px 0 rgba(0,0,0,.14),0 1px 2px 0 rgba(0,0,0,.12);box-shadow:0 1px 1px -1px rgba(0,0,0,.2),0 1px 1px 0 rgba(0,0,0,.14),0 1px 2px 0 rgba(0,0,0,.12);display:-webkit-box;display:-ms-flexbox;display:flex;cursor:pointer}@media(max-width:550px){.icon-scroll{bottom:3%;right:45%;-webkit-filter:opacity(80%);-moz-filter:opacity(80%);-o-filter:opacity(80%);-ms-filter:opacity(80%);filter:opacity(80%)}}.icon-scroll-op{color:#000!important;-webkit-filter:opacity(100%);-moz-filter:opacity(100%);-o-filter:opacity(100%);-ms-filter:opacity(100%);filter:opacity(100%)}.imagem-sem-mensagem{width:100%;height:50vh;margin-top:2%;margin-left:-4vw;background-size:auto;background-position:50%;background-repeat:no-repeat;position:absolute;background-image:url(https://arquitask-imagens.s3.amazonaws.com/logos/novaconversa.png);-webkit-filter:invert(50%);filter:invert(50%)}@media(max-width:550px){.imagem-sem-mensagem{background-size:70%}}.fundo{width:100vw;height:calc(100vh - 3rem);background-image:url(https://arquitask-imagens.s3.amazonaws.com/wallpaper/parede.jpg);background-attachment:fixed;background-size:cover;background-position:bottom;background-repeat:no-repeat;max-height:100vh;position:absolute;z-index:0;-webkit-filter:opacity(40%);-moz-filter:opacity(40%);-o-filter:opacity(40%);-ms-filter:opacity(40%);filter:opacity(40%)}.conteudo{z-index:1}.scrollable{height:120px;overflow-y:unset;z-index:0}@media(max-width:550px){.scrollable{height:35%}}.typer{-webkit-box-sizing:border-box;box-sizing:border-box;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;bottom:0;height:4.9rem;width:95%;position:relative;margin:auto;background-color:hsla(0,0%,84.3%,.8)}@media(max-width:550px){.typer{position:fixed;width:100%;height:3rem}}.typer input[type=text]{left:2vw;padding:2%;width:80%;background-color:transparent;border:none;outline:none;font-size:1.25rem}.typer-button{margin-right:2%!important}.titulo-chat{height:44px;padding-top:1vh;padding-left:2vw;background-color:hsla(0,0%,84.3%,.8)}@media(max-width:550px){.titulo-chat{height:30px;margin-top:15px!important;font-size:12px}}.blur-cabecalho{background-color:hsla(0,0%,84.3%,.8)}.chat-container{-webkit-box-sizing:border-box;box-sizing:border-box;margin-bottom:calc(var(--vh, 5px));height:calc(100vh - 285px);overflow-y:auto;padding-top:1vw;padding-left:3vw;padding-right:3vw}@media(max-width:550px){.chat-container{height:calc(100vh - 12rem);margin-bottom:calc(var(--vh))}}.message{text-align:right}.message.own{text-align:left}.message.own .conteudo{background-color:#87cefa}.chat-container .usuario{font-size:18px;font-weight:700}.chat-container .conteudo{padding:20px 22px;background-color:#90ee90;border-radius:10px;display:inline-block;-webkit-box-shadow:0 1px 3px 0 rgba(0,0,0,.2),0 1px 1px 0 rgba(0,0,0,.14),0 2px 1px -1px rgba(0,0,0,.12);box-shadow:0 1px 3px 0 rgba(0,0,0,.2),0 1px 1px 0 rgba(0,0,0,.14),0 2px 1px -1px rgba(0,0,0,.12);max-width:50%;overflow-wrap:break-word;text-align:left}@media(max-width:480px){.chat-container .conteudo{font-size:13px;max-width:73%}}.loading{color:#546e7a;height:44px;padding-top:8px;padding-left:2vw;font-size:14px}@media(max-width:550px){.loading{height:30px;margin-top:-14px;font-size:11px}}.loading:after{overflow:hidden;display:inline-block;vertical-align:bottom;-webkit-animation:ellipsis 2.5s steps(4) infinite;animation:ellipsis 2.5s steps(4) infinite;content:"…";width:0}@keyframes ellipsis{to{width:1.25em}}@-webkit-keyframes ellipsis{to{width:1.25em}}